Samsung confirms Galaxy S8 will come with an AI assistant service

November 8, 2016 By Siddhanth Leave a Comment

Samsung logo

If Samsung’s acquisition of Viv wasn’t a clear cut confirmation, Samsung has confirmed to Reuters that their upcoming Galaxy S8 smartphone will feature an AI digital assistant service. The service will understandably make use of Viv’s solution which, in the future, will be expanded to other Samsung devices like home appliances and wearables.

Samsung is keeping minute details for the big reveal next year but confirmed the AI assistant will allow users to use third-party services once developers “attach and upload” it to their agent.

Samsung has previously dabbled with assistant service in the form of S Voice but has not been up to the mark when compared to Apple’s Siri.
